Transaction 371721367377adaeb08a723080609ff328f837118cc8832ac41edfaeb595a568

1 Input
2 Outputs
  • 371721367377adaeb08a723080609ff328f837118cc8832ac41edfaeb595a568:0
  • value  2831331
    address  3BAJpiBWKLFNz29Kd5dLsjNqtGPvYm4mtY
  • 371721367377adaeb08a723080609ff328f837118cc8832ac41edfaeb595a568:1
  • value  569088773
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o